paleBLUEdot Selected for City of Bloomington Climate Action Plan

paleBLUEdot was selected by the City of Bloomington for the City’s first Climate Vulnerability Assessment and Climate Action Plan.  Bloomington is nestled in the rolling hills of southern Indiana and home to 85,000 residents and serves as a home away from home for tens of thousands of Indiana University students and alumni.  

The City of Bloomington has a long-standing commitment to sustainability. City programs and community efforts focused on energy conservation, waste reduction, solar development, and the growth of the local food market have established Bloomington as a regional sustainability leader.  The City of Bloomington addresses sustainability through careful attention to environmental, economic, and social equity issues. Sustainability and livability are guiding principles and are considered to be foundational to quality, long-lasting economic and community development

Bloomington’s vision is to be climate resilient, leading in the social and economic transitions necessary to reduce citywide greenhouse gas emissions in accordance with the Paris Climate Agreement, while protecting Bloomington’s natural ecosystems, most vulnerable populations, and economic vitality against the increasing impacts of climate change. 

The Climate Vulnerability Assessment will provide a detailed review of the anticipated climate-related risks to people, infrastructure, and natural resources in Bloomington and Monroe County. The assessment will also consider the potential impacts on the local energy, economic, and food systems due to a changing climate.  This assessment will detail how climate change is affecting Bloomington now, identify current and future climate vulnerabilities, and how those vulnerabilities will change in coming decades.  The plan will also recommend strategies for the City and community to prepare for and adapt to local climate change effects and reduce carbon emissions over the next 10 years.

The paleBLUEdot Climate Action Plan effort will include:

  1. Detailed review of City Greenhouse Gas Inventory and characteristics

  2. Development of a Climate Vulnerability and Risk Assessment meeting Global Covenant of Mayors (GCoM) requirements

  3. Defining a city-specific emissions mitigation target based on Bloomington Greenhouse Gas Emission Inventories

  4. Recommend city-specific climate adaptation and mitigation actions that the city and community can undertake with an analysis of barriers and opportunities.

  5. Leading Climate Action Planning Public Engagement

  6. Development of the Climate Action Plan and Implementation Matrix

  7. Development of Communications Campaign for the first year of climate action implementation
